import {$isElementNode, $isTextNode, RootNode, TextNode} from 'lexical';

/**
 * Finds a TextNode with a size larger than targetCharacters and returns
 * the node along with the remaining length of the text.
 * @param root - The RootNode.
 * @param targetCharacters - The number of characters whose TextNode must be larger than.
 * @returns The TextNode and the intersections offset, or null if no TextNode is found.
 * @deprecated $findTextIntersectionFromCharacters has never worked correctly and will be removed
 */
export function $findTextIntersectionFromCharacters(
  root: RootNode,
  targetCharacters: number,
): null | {node: TextNode; offset: number} {
  let node = root.getFirstChild();
  let currentCharacters = 0;

  mainLoop: while (node !== null) {
    if ($isElementNode(node)) {
      const child = node.getFirstChild();

      if (child !== null) {
        node = child;
        continue;
      }
    } else if ($isTextNode(node)) {
      const characters = node.getTextContentSize();

      if (currentCharacters + characters > targetCharacters) {
        return {node, offset: targetCharacters - currentCharacters};
      }
      currentCharacters += characters;
    }
    const sibling = node.getNextSibling();

    if (sibling !== null) {
      node = sibling;
      continue;
    }
    let parent = node.getParent();
    while (parent !== null) {
      const parentSibling = parent.getNextSibling();

      if (parentSibling !== null) {
        node = parentSibling;
        continue mainLoop;
      }
      parent = parent.getParent();
    }
    break;
  }

  return null;
}
